Produced late in 2019, this Evo specification 488 GTE was delivered new to the Iron Lynx team ahead of the 24 Hours of Le Mans the following year. A fire ended its sole outing during the 2020 season. It was pressed back in service in 2021 when it scored three GTE class wins in the European Le Mans Series. Chassis 3858 was also entered in the 24 Hours of Le Mans for a second time, this time finishing 27th overall and third in class. Iron Lynx continued to race the 488 GTE Evo during the following with another ELMS campaign and select outings in the FIA World Endurance Championship. Among them were entries in the 2022 Sebring 1000 Miles and, for a third time, the 24 Hours of Le Mans. A fitting finale to the three-season racing career of 3858 came a the Portimão ELMS round where it was driven to another LMGTE class win by Sarah Bovy, Michelle Gatting and Doriane Pin. Following its retirement, it was restored to its 2021 Le Mans podium finishing livery. Retained by the original owner, it was consigned to a dedicated RM Sotheby’s auction along with the rest of the ‘Tailored for Speed Collection.’
